BMS Digital Safety: Why It's More Critical Than Ever

The escalating reliance on Building Management Systems (BMS) for everything from climate management to security and life safety presents a major challenge: digital safety. Historically, these systems were often isolated, creating a relatively secure environment. However, modern BMS increasingly connect to the internet via cloud platforms, opening them up to a wider range of cyber threats. These compromises aren’t just about disrupting services; they can have real-world consequences, potentially impacting occupant safety, property damage, and even regulatory ramifications. Therefore, prioritizing BMS digital safety is no longer a luxury , but an absolute necessity. Failing to do so leaves buildings vulnerable to malicious actors who could exploit these weaknesses.
